Transaction 43ec11e101770cb690aec783022d57223ff04548950f4c2f5b6f2240c0d4fd78
3 Input
2 Outputs
- 43ec11e101770cb690aec783022d57223ff04548950f4c2f5b6f2240c0d4fd78:0
- 43ec11e101770cb690aec783022d57223ff04548950f4c2f5b6f2240c0d4fd78:1
value 650000
address 19Mc28h2B2zTxEsBipPP8RctNMfPHoxDMJ
value 12582617
address 3BMEX8sBjmGPMuFHacR4wx3KmcAMkZrYEK